Page 1 of 1

keybdhook.dll error when starting TrackIR

Posted: Tue Dec 02, 2008 8:51 pm
by thekingofstyle
I just updated from TrackIR 4.0.20 to TrackIR 4.1.036.

I'm using Windows 2000.

The earlier version was running acceptably, but I wanted to get support for Armed Assault and get the updated tracking.

I went through the installation and now when I double click the trackir.exe I get the following message

"The procedure entry point ?SetKBhotKeys@@YAXKHH@Z could not be located in the dynamic link library Keybdhook.dll"

Yesterday I had tried removing the old version and doing a clean install of 4.1.036 and it wouldn't run either, but it showed no error message.

Ideas to get it working?

Re: keybdhook.dll error when starting TrackIR

Posted: Wed Dec 03, 2008 11:07 am
by VincentG
Looking at the system device manager, how is the device listed (USB or Naturalpoint)?

Connected directly to the PC, or using a hub?

Re: keybdhook.dll error when starting TrackIR

Posted: Wed Dec 03, 2008 5:09 pm
by thekingofstyle
Connected directly, and I have a device listing of Natural Point Devices, with a sublevel of Natural Point Track IR 3.

Driver version 2.41.0.1338. The file name of the driver is npusbio.sys

I tried deleting the keybdhook.dll and then got a cameradll.dll error message.

Thanks

Re: keybdhook.dll error when starting TrackIR

Posted: Wed Dec 03, 2008 5:25 pm
by VincentG
Was the software running, when you tried to delete the dll file?